Andrew Turner
6238905c5b Only change DMAP props on DMAP covered memory
When changing memory properties in the arm64 pmap we need to keep both
the kernel address and DMAP mappings in sync.

To keep the kernel and DMAP memory in sync we recurse when updating the
former to also update the latter. There was insuffucuent checking around
this recursion. It would check if the virtual address is not within the
DMAP region, but not if the physical address is covered.

Add the missing check as without it the recursion may return an error.

Mark Johnston
3aa0bc89c6 libdwarf: Add a weak uncompress() symbol
This works around brokenness in buildworld's bootstrapping logic: it
uses the source tree's metadata to collect dependency info (such as,
"libdwarf depends on libz") but links against static host libraries.
If these two are out of sync, as is the case if one builds a commit
prior to the introduction of the libz dependency, then the build fails
when trying to statically link nm(1).

Mitigate the problem by defining a weak uncompress() symbol which simply
returns an error.  This ensures that the build won't fail when
statically linking libdwarf without zlib.  The downside is that any
tools using libdwarf without zlib will now hit a runtime error if they
attempt to decode compressed sections, but at least they'll fail
deterministically, and compressed debug info is only enabled by default
in main.

In particular, this fixes building of branches lacking commit
dbf05458e3, such as releng branches, stable/12 and 13 and old
revisions of main.  Previously the nm(1) build would fail with:

Cy Schubert
8f19f3d31a ipfilter: Fix struct ifnet pointer type
The fr_info struct contains a summary of a packet. One of its fields
is a pointer to the ifnet struct the packet arrived on. It is pointed
to by a void* because ipfilter supports multiple O/Ses. Unfortunately
this makes it difficult it examine with DTrace. Defining fin_ifp as a
pointer to an ifnet struct makes the struct it points to using a DTrace
script possible.

Andriy Gapon
df472af034 mmc_sim: fix setting of the mutex name
To quote the manual:
 The pointer passed in as name and type is saved rather than the data
 it points to.  The data pointed to must remain stable until the mutex
 is destroyed.

It seems that the type is actually copied, but the name is stored as
a pointer indeed.
mmc_cam_sim_alloc used a name stored on stack.
So, a corrupt mutex name would be reported.
For example:
  lock order reversal: (sleepable after non-sleepable)
  1st 0xd7285b20 <8A><C0><C0>P@<C1><D0>P@<C1>^D^A (aw_mmc_sim, sleep mutex) @ /usr/devel/git/orange/sys/cam/cam_xpt.c:2804

This change moves the name to struct mmc_sim.
Also, that name is used as the sim name as well.
Unused mtx_name variable is removed too.
